RoHS Directive compliant
: In accordance with European Directive 2002/95/EC, "RoHS Directive compliant" means that the product or 
part does not contain any of the following substances in excess of the following maximum concentration values in any homogeneous 
material, unless the substance is in an application that is exempt under RoHS: (a) 0.1% (by weight) for lead, mercury, hexavalent chromium, 
polybrominated biphenyls or polybrominated diphenyl ethers; or (b) 0.01% (by weight) for cadmium. Unless otherwise stated by 3M in 
writing, this information represents 3M’s knowledge and belief based on information provided by third party suppliers to 3M. (9/06)
